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a PTE Preparation Center

1. Accreditation and Reputation

When selecting a PTE preparation center, start by checking its credentials:

  • Look for centers officially recognized by Pearson
  • Research online reviews and testimonials from past students
  • Check the center’s success rate and average score improvements
  • Inquire about the qualifications and experience of the instructors

2. Curriculum and Teaching Methodology

A reliable PTE preparation center should offer a comprehensive and well-structured curriculum:

  • Ensure the center covers all four language skills: speaking, writing, reading, and listening
  • Look for a balance between theory and practice
  • Check if they use authentic PTE practice materials
  • Inquire about their teaching methods (e.g., interactive sessions, personalized feedback)

3. Resources and Materials

The quality of study materials can significantly impact your preparation:

  • Verify if the center provides up-to-date PTE practice tests
  • Check if they offer online resources for self-study
  • Inquire about access to PTE-specific software and tools
  • Look for centers that provide supplementary materials like vocabulary lists and grammar guides

4. Class Size and Individual Attention

Smaller class sizes often lead to more personalized attention:

  • Ask about the average student-to-teacher ratio
  • Inquire if one-on-one tutoring options are available
  • Check if the center offers personalized study plans
  • Look for centers that provide regular progress assessments

5. Flexibility and Scheduling

Consider how the center’s schedule aligns with your needs:

  • Check if they offer both weekday and weekend classes
  • Look for centers with flexible timing options (morning, afternoon, evening)
  • Inquire about the duration of the course and intensity levels
  • Ask if they provide online or hybrid learning options

6. Mock Tests and Feedback

Regular practice tests and constructive feedback are crucial for improvement:

  • Ensure the center conducts regular mock PTE exams
  • Check if they provide detailed feedback on your performance
  • Look for centers that offer strategies to improve weak areas
  • Ask if they have a system to track your progress over time

7. Success Rate and Guarantees

While no center can guarantee specific scores, look for those with a track record of success:

  • Ask for data on their students’ average score improvements
  • Inquire about the percentage of students who achieve their target scores
  • Check if they offer any form of guarantee or additional support if you don’t reach your goal
  • Look for centers that showcase student success stories

8. Location and Facilities

The learning environment can impact your study experience:

  • Consider the center’s proximity to your home or workplace
  • Check if they have modern facilities and technology
  • Ensure they have a quiet and conducive study environment
  • Look for centers with additional amenities like libraries or computer labs

Red Flags to Watch Out For

Be wary of PTE preparation centers that:

  • Promise unrealistically high scores or quick results
  • Use outdated materials or non-official practice tests
  • Have instructors with no verifiable qualifications or experience
  • Offer extremely low prices compared to other reputable centers
  • Have no clear curriculum or study plan
  • Refuse to provide references or past student testimonials

Steps to Take After Choosing a PTE Preparation Center

Once you’ve selected a reliable PTE preparation center:

  1. Attend an orientation session to familiarize yourself with the program
  2. Take a diagnostic test to assess your current level
  3. Work with your instructor to set realistic goals and create a study plan
  4. Commit to regular attendance and active participation
  5. Utilize all available resources, including online materials and practice tests
  6. Seek additional help or clarification when needed
  7. Track your progress and adjust your study plan accordingly
